Modern Floor to Ceiling Built In Wardrobe Design

A built-in wardrobe like this usually helps the wall look complete instead of being broken into smaller storage sections.

Key Design Details:

  • Floor-to-ceiling layout increases storage space.
  • Built-in design keeps the wall neat.
  • Works well with neutral finishes.
  • Reduces the need for extra cabinets.
  • Suitable for everyday bedroom layouts.

Is a built-in wardrobe better than a standalone one?

Many homeowners prefer built-in storage because it uses the wall more efficiently and creates a cleaner wardrobe design for bedroom without adding extra furniture pieces later.

Will full-height wardrobes make the room look smaller?

Not when lighter finishes are selected. They often make the wall appear more structured as part of a balanced modern wardrobe design.

Is this layout suitable for long-term use?

Yes. Built-in storage usually adapts well over time to changing home interior ideas.
